Ibn Hazm of Cordoba: The Life and Works of a Controversial Thinker (Handbook of Oriental Studies) (Handbook of Oriental Studies: Section 1; The Near and Middle East) by Camilla Adang
English | 2012 | ISBN: 9004234241 | 828 Pages | PDF | 4.98 MB

This volume represents the state of the art in research on the Muslim legal scholar, theologian and man of letters Ibn azm of Cordoba (d. 456/1064), who is widely regarded as one of the most brilliant minds of Islamic Spain.
